Building a Satellite Suited for Nuriho… Space Agency Begins Developing Korean Environmental Testing Standards.

Summary by ddaily.co.kr
[Digital Daily Reporter Baek Ji-young] The Korea Aerospace Science and Technology Administration (KASA) has begun developing "Korean Satellite Environmental Testing Standards" to produce satellites optimized for domestic launch vehicles. The goal is to reorganize the testing system, which has relied on US and European standards during the domestic satellite development process, to suit the Korean launch environment.
